From Expo / Western to Hemet by bus and train
To get from Expo / Western to Hemet in Los Angeles, you’ll need to take 2 bus lines and one train line: take the 40 bus from Martin Luther King Jr / Western station to Alameda / Los Angeles station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the 91-PV LINE train and finally take the 28 bus from Perris Transit Center station to Florida + Cawston station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 4 hr 54 min. The ride fare is $15.00.
